BENGALURU: The High Court on Wednesday directed the CID to file a final report in eight weeks before the jurisdictional court with regard to unaccounted cash worth Rs 1.98 crore which was allegedly seized from the car of advocate H M Siddartha in the Vidhana Soudha premises in October last year.

Justice Anand Byrareddy passed the interim order while asking the investigating agency to take the permission of the court in case it wants to further interrogate Siddhartha, son of a former district judge.

During the arguments, the state public prosecutor appealed to the court to give some time to complete the investigation, saying that Siddhartha was giving different replies.

The counsel for Siddhartha argued that the investigating agency has still not made a case against the accused as mentioned in the FIR registered on October 21, 2016, though he was interrogated many times.
